Amid cost overruns and climate concerns, the $34-billion Trans Mountain pipeline expansion project has finally opened, with oil-and-gas advocate Dan McTeague saying the project shows the 'vital' importance of pipelines in getting this country's fuel reserves to market as demand for energy increases globally. Experts have also expressed concerns that this pipeline project may be the last in Canada.
